1. The Essence of Cannabis Terpenes:

Defining Terpenes:

Terpenes are aromatic compounds found in various plants, including cannabis.

In cannabis, terpenes are responsible for the distinctive scents and flavors of different strains.

Beyond Aesthetics:

Terpenes contribute to more than just the sensory experience; they also influence the therapeutic and recreational effects of cannabis.

3. Aromatherapy and Cannabis:

Therapeutic Benefits:

Terpenes extend beyond aroma, offering therapeutic benefits.

Certain terpenes, like linalool and beta-caryophyllene, may have anti-anxiety and anti-inflammatory properties.

Holistic Approach:

Aromatherapy with cannabis terpenes can enhance the overall wellness experience.

The entourage effect, where cannabinoids and terpenes work synergistically, contributes to holistic benefits.

4. Diverse Terpene Strains:

Myrcene-Dominant Strains:

Strains high in myrcene, such as Granddaddy Purple, may have relaxing and sedative effects.

Explore myrcene-rich strains for a more calming experience.

Limonene-Prominent Strains:

Citrusy strains with limonene, like Lemon Haze, are associated with uplifting and energizing effects.

Limonene contributes to a vibrant and refreshing cannabis experience.
